生化/生理作用
TXNRD2 (thioredoxin reductase 2) gene encodes a protein belonging to the class I pyridine nucleotide-disulfide oxidoreductase family. It is a selenocysteine-containing enzyme that functions in scavenging of mitochondrial oxygen radicals. Mutations in this gene may cause dilated cardiomyopathy. Excessive generation or accumulation of oxygen radicals can cause tissue injury and functional deterioration after myocardial ischemia/reperfusion. These radicals are scavenged by thioredoxin reductase 2, thus protecting against myocardial ischemia/reperfusion injury.
